Exim Bank BDO Recruitment 2026: 12 Posts
Exim Bank BDO Recruitment 2026 Overview
The Export-Import Bank of India (Exim Bank) has announced recruitment for 12 Business Development Officer (BDO) positions on a contract basis. This is a chance for eligible candidates with postgraduate qualifications and relevant experience to join the bank.

Vacancy Details
Exim Bank is looking to fill 12 vacancies for the post of Business Development Officer. The distribution of vacancies is as follows:
- UR (Unreserved): 7
- OBC (NCL) (Other Backward Classes - Non-Creamy Layer): 3
- SC (Scheduled Caste): 1
- EWS (Economically Weaker Sections): 1
Eligibility Criteria
Candidates must meet the following educational and experience requirements to be eligible for the BDO post:
Educational Qualification- Postgraduate in Marketing/Finance.
- MBA with specialization in Finance or Marketing is preferred.
- Postgraduation must be a minimum of a 2-year full-time duration from a recognized University/Institution.
- Minimum 55% aggregate marks or equivalent CGPA in both Graduation and Post-Graduation.
- Minimum 02 years of post-qualification experience.
- Experience should be in Banks, Financial Institutions, or Upper Layer NBFCs.
- The experience should be in areas like marketing of products and services for Corporate Loans Syndication, Corporate Credit, etc.
The candidate should not be more than 35 years of age as on August 31, 2026.
Compensation
The compensation offered for the Business Development Officer position is Rs. 14.68 lakh per annum. This includes fixed and variable components in a ratio of 80:20. Annual increments are provided for the first two years of work experience. The compensation may increase based on the Bank's pay matrix for candidates with more work experience.
Selection Process
Exim Bank will shortlist eligible candidates for a personal interview. The interview will be conducted at the Bank's office in Mumbai or New Delhi. Only shortlisted candidates will be informed about the interview details.
Candidates will be shortlisted for interviews in a 1:10 ratio. A list will be prepared from candidates who meet all the prescribed eligibility criteria. If more than 10 candidates are found eligible, a further shortlist will be made based on the percentage score obtained in the post-graduation examination.
The Bank reserves the right to relax eligibility criteria for experience, age, and essential qualifications if there is a limited response or an insufficient number of eligible candidates.
